What’s The Difference Between Sport Climbing And Traditional Climbing?

This fashion of climbing is extremely secure, and the danger to the climber is minimised. Traditional or trad climbing entails rock climbing routes in which safety in opposition to falls is placed by the climber whereas ascending. In the bizarre event bolts are used, these are positioned on lead (usually with a handbook drill). More generally removable gear called cams, hexes, and nuts are positioned in constrictions or cracks within the rock to guard towards falls (instead of bolts) but to not help the ascent instantly. Due to the difficulty of placing bolts on lead, bolts are typically positioned farther aside than on many sport climbs.

It’s used on the finish of a climbing route when it can’t be safely or simply walked-off from the highest—or if climbers have to bail from a route when the climb turns into unsafe or inconceivable given the situations or climber’s capacity. Rappelling is most frequently done using a belay gadget; it requires an anchor to be left behind—both within the form of permanent bolts, or webbing round a rock feature or tree. Free soloing—the type of mountain climbing that’s just lately become publicly seen because of Alex Honnold—happens when the climber performs alone without using any ropes, a harness, or different protective tools. The climber instead depends on their capability to finish the ascent.

Aid climbing is a method of mountaineering the place the climber attaches devices to pieces of safety and stands on those gadgets to make upward progress. It is typically reserved for climbs that are too steep, lengthy, and troublesome for free climbing. Aid climbing is the most popular way to ascend big walls like these present in Yosemite. In indoor climbing gyms, quickdraws (two non-locking carabiners linked with webbing) are pre-positioned on the bolts in order that a lead climber only has to clip the rope in as she or he ascends the route.

For a single pitch climbs, the route could be accomplished in just one pitch, which is belayed from the bottom. Multi-pitch climbs nonetheless, require two or more pitches to complete the route. On a multi-pitch route, a brand new belay is created in between pitches at every new anchor; oftentimes the lead climber and follower alternate roles climbing leading or belaying and then following and belaying at every station until the ascent is complete. Rappelling is the managed descent of a vertical face by the climber himself or herself—not to be confused with reducing, which is what a belayer might do for the climber at the end of a climb to get them again to the bottom.

Rock climbing helmets are one of the extra necessary safety items essential for mountaineering. Draws are used to connect the rope to a chunk of protection whereas climbing.

For a fast-draw, two non-locking carabiners are linked by a bit of quick, pre-sewn webbing. One of the carabiners is commonly free, whereas the opposite is saved rigidly in place with a rubber strap, to assist in efficient clipping of the rope. Alternately, two non-locking carabiners may be related by a bit of shoulder-length (60cm/24in) webbing to create alpine-attracts, which have a larger versatility in length. Quick-draws are most often utilized in sport climbs which are normally immediately bolted, whereas alpine draws shine in a trad or multi-pitch environments the place routes are more wandering.

While these accidents happen, the authors imply they didn’t happen often. However, somebody who climbs three-4 days a week would possibly take one thousand lead falls a 12 months.

With that in mind, Schöffl and Küpper counsel climbers ought to fall with their palms up and slightly ahead and with toes down and slightly forward as well. They clarify that this methodology of falling would permit the climber to make contact with the wall with limbs that can absorb pressure, quite than with different much less-absorbent elements of the physique. After impression, Schöffl and Küpper instruct the climber to grab the rope (it’s utterly stretched out and unable to trigger injury) so as to refrain from tipping the other way up. This technique of falling will get rid of accidents brought on by prematurely grabbing the rope or different pieces of protection, in addition to virtually eliminating neck injuries.

Blood pressure has not been immediately measured throughout climbing, although there may be reason to suspect that climbers have a unique blood pressure response to arm train from non-climbers. Ferguson and Brown18 showed an attenuated blood strain response to isometric handgrip train in trained climbers compared with untrained subjects. The reduction in blood strain may have been brought on by a desensitisation of afferent fibres or by a decreased build up of metabolites, which would trigger much less stimulation of the muscle metaboreflex and the coincident rise in systemic arterial strain.

However, a cautious approach should be taken when decoding these results. Most climbing studies have used completely different climbing intensities or subjects with variable climbing experience/ability levels. Despite this caveat, it is affordable to conclude that a significant accumulation of blood lactate coincides with climbing, and it increases with climbing issue. It must be famous that blood lactate concentrations are decrease with climbing than with actions corresponding to operating or biking. This might be because a smaller energetic muscle mass is producing lactate.

It appears that when climbers are at their maximal climbing capacity, blood lactate is about 5 mmol/l.

Blood lactate concentrations can stay raised for as much as 20 minutes after a climb.4 To date, just one investigation has attempted to govern recovery methods and determine the effect on blood lactate. Watts et al3 had topics climb near-maximally after which perform both passive restoration or active recovery (recumbent leg cycling at 25 W for 10 minutes).
